Double Glazing Repair Near Me

Double-glazed windows improve the efficiency of your home's energy use and provide insulation. However, they might require repair periodically.

A blown window pane is a serious issue that needs to be fixed immediately. The cost to fix the damaged window will depend on the kind of repair required.

Glass Replacement

There are instances when replacing the glass of a window is the only alternative. It is possible to replace the glass if the window is damaged beyond repair or the frame is damaged and decayed. It's not difficult or expensive to replace the glass in double-glazed windows. Many homeowners find it more affordable to keep the frame they have and upgrade to more energy-efficient or aesthetically pleasing glass than to replace them with new windows.

Owners of double glazing often report that their doors and windows are difficult to open or close. This is usually the result of a damaged latch or other hardware. It can be fixed by cooling it down and then lubricating it.

Another common problem that can be addressed by a specialist is a accumulation of condensation between window panes. This can result in water leaking into the room and cause damp and mold. It poses a serious health risk and can also impact the window's ability as an insulator.

A professional can clean and eliminate any moisture that may be present between the window panes, restoring the clarity of your double glazing. They can also replace the seals that are between the window panes in order to restore the function of the windows and insulate your home.

The cost of replacing all the glass on windows with larger dimensions like bow and bay windows with multiple angled panes will be more expensive. However, the average costs of repairing one blown window is PS100 or less, which is a lot less expensive than the cost of purchasing and installing an entire replacement window unit. The restoration of your insulated windows to their original state will make them more energy efficient and save money on your utility bills in the long run. Frame Replacement

Double-glazed windows are double-paned and have a gap between the two panes. The gap is filled with gas or air. This gap acts as insulation that keeps warm air inside and cold air out, and also reduces outside noise. These windows are popular for this reason. However, in some cases, these windows will require repair due to wear and tear or other problems.

Misty Panes

Double glazed windows are a great addition to any home and are great at providing insulation, however sometimes moisture may form between the glass panes. This can lead to a variety of problems in your home, such as mould growth and dampness. It could also raise your energy bills. This is particularly true in older properties that weren't equipped with double glazing repairs near me-glazed windows to a top-quality standard.

Professionals are able to quickly and easily repair windows that have become misty. The procedure involves removing the damaged glass and blowing hot air through the gap to dry out any moisture. Then a new seal will be put in place and the window will be fully functional once again.

In some cases an expert will be able to perform the resealing process that will aid in preventing the problem from happening again in the future. This process can also be used on single pane windows when the issue is due to condensation and not a leak.

One method of fixing a misty window is to drill a hole through the window and then insert a desiccant packet into it. This is not a great long-term solution as it could cause damage to the window at the worst and allow dust, moisture and debris to get through at the very least.

It is suggested homeowners call a specialist window repair company to make any necessary repairs to double glazing when they spot problems. This will ensure that any issues are dealt with as quickly as possible before they grow into a bigger issue like mould or damp.

The condensation in your double-glazed windows can cause a range of problems including mould, rotting frames, and even health issues such as asthma or respiratory infections. Therefore, fixing a misty window early on is essential to minimize damage to your home and increase the comfort of your household. This is especially crucial in the winter when excess moisture leads to cold homes and higher utility bills. Cracked Panes

Double-pane windows are extremely durable, they can still crack or break. You should seek out a double glazing near me immediately when you spot a crack on your window. The experts can fix the frame and replace the broken pane to make it safer and energy efficient. They can also repair double-paned windows that have lost their gas fills. This helps keep the heat in during winter, and keep cold outside in summer.

You may be enticed by the crack in your window to repair it yourself. This is not something you can do without the right knowledge and tools. It is safer to delegate this task to a double glazing repair technician near me, who has the right tools and equipment to complete the job. It's risky to try to repair or replace double-paned glass yourself. You could suffer serious injuries.

Cracks in double-pane windows can be a major problem and should be fixed as soon as is possible. This is because a cracked pane will compromise the gas layer that is between the glass and helps protect the window from heat and keep outside air from entering your home. Cracks that are left unattended will likely worsen in time, which could cause the glass to shatter.

Clear tape is the easiest way to repair a cracked window that has double panes. This will strengthen the crack, and can also help to insulate your windows by keeping bugs and cold air out. This is not a permanent fix, but it will help you until you can get a permanent fix.

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gAnother option is to cut a piece plastic from a shower curtain, shopping bag, or tarp and fix it to the crack. This will also insulate your window, but it will not appear very attractive. You can also use super glue on the crack to prevent it from spreading. But, these aren't the best options if want to keep your windows looking nice and functioning effectively.
